Output e05ca46185017ec4fa982b8eaaec1e3f30623e85f1d6a322ba604dbc1710b03a:3

value
2523877
script pubkey
OP_0 OP_PUSHBYTES_32 e16d05e0f16d3bdf794b8ef9ed894da80fff7f81970a30863df9e47a3cbd1255
address
bc1qu9kstc83d5aa772t3mu7mz2d4q8l7lupju9rpp3al8j8509azf2slu2vjr
transaction
e05ca46185017ec4fa982b8eaaec1e3f30623e85f1d6a322ba604dbc1710b03a
spent
true